Ukraine will not become a member of the European Union and NATO, because Europe does not have enough money for this. This opinion was expressed by Hungarian Prime Minister Viktor Orban, speaking in the Romanian city of Baile Tusnad, broadcast by the TV channel. M1.
Orban said that the European Union has already lost in the Ukraine conflict and will not be able to finance either the continuation of hostilities, the restoration of Ukraine or its “current functioning” if the US role in it weakens.
“We need to prepare for the fact that Ukraine will not become a member of either the EU or NATO, because we Europeans do not have enough money for this,” Orban said.
He noted that Ukraine would “return to the position of a buffer state” with international security guarantees in the foreseeable future.
In the same speech, Orban statedThe EU will have to pay the price for the “military adventure in Ukraine.” According to him, after Donald Trump’s probable victory in the US elections, European politicians will have to “admit defeat” on this issue.
